ORIGINAL: Oneshot7 I dont need a wrist wrap or a stabilizer on the bow 445 dollars is my top cost since i already have a release Right now if you patrol the sporting goods aisle at Wall mart you might be able to pick up a strap for about $5 and a stabilizer for maybe $10. You don't need anything fancy, just something that will put a little mass away from center. The strap doesn't need to be anything fancy either. I'd also suggest giving yourself a bit more than 2 or 3 months if you've never bow hunted before. You want to be as confident as possible in your abilities |
